Что этот девайс, из себя представлят - это устройство, которое выклчает питание по таймеру и дает возможностьуправлять розеткой с расстояния. Можно сказать, что уже есть умные розетки, котороми можно управлять даже с телефона, но я не ищу легких путей. Нужно все испытать.

Задумка алгоритма

Устройство должно состоять из двух частей: 1-передатчик и 2-приемник. Данные по радиоканалу должны передаваться зашифрованными и если были записанными, то не могли быть многократно воспроизведены.

Читать далее...

Обзор двух способов:

  1. как развести дорожки печатной платы с помощью KiCAD 5+FreeRoute
  2. как эмулировать входной сигнал при отладке в симуляторе Atmel Studio

Читать далее...

memleax отлаживает и находит утечки памяти без перезагрузки сервиса или процесса и без перекомпилляции.

Установка:

wget http://download.opensuse.org/repositories/home:/bayrepo/CentOS_7/home:bayrepo.repo -O /etc/yum.repos.d/home:bayrepo.repo
yum install memleax -y

Детали описания: http://docs....

Читать далее...

Пусть необходимо отладить процесс, запускаемый из другого процесса и быстро завершающийся.

Пример: нужно отладить расширение PHP, PHP настроен как cgi, т.е процесс запускается при появлении запроса и быстро завершается.

В отладке поможет systemtap.

Читать далее...

В этой статье не планирую ставить никакого задания. Просто буду собирать полезные сценарии из интернета и возможно - описывать свои. А так же вставлю ссылки на полезные статьи по исследованию и описанию работы некоторых функций glibc, для дальнейшей возможности обследования их через systemtap.

Сценарий 1

Интересный скрипт, позволяющий остановить выполнение программы в нужном месте и запустить gdb

Читать далее...